Patch 8.2.1654
Problem:    When job writes to hidden buffer current window has display
            errors.  (Johnny McArthur)
Solution:   Use aucmd_prepbuf() instead of switch_to_win_for_buf().
            (closes #6925)
Files:      src/channel.c
